Types of Beauty Blush Brushes

1. Traditional Blush Brush

The traditional blush brush is typically fluffy and rounded, designed for blending blush seamlessly onto the skin. This type allows for a natural finish, making it ideal for powder blushes.

2. Angled Blush Brush

An angled blush brush is perfect for contouring and adding dimension to your face. The sloped bristles make it easier to apply blush precisely to the apples of your cheeks while giving you the ability to sculpt your cheekbones.

3. Dual-Ended Blush Brush

For the multitasker, a dual-ended blush brush is a fantastic choice. This brush often features one side for blush application and the other for highlighter or bronzer, making it versatile and travel-friendly.

How to Choose the Right Beauty Blush Brush

1. Consider the Blush Formula

The type of blush you use—cream, liquid, or powder—will influence the brush you need. For powder blush, a fluffy brush is best, while cream blushes work well with dense, synthetic bristle brushes that can blend product effectively.

2. Look for Quality Materials

High-quality brushes often feature natural or synthetic bristles. Natural bristles are great for powder products, whereas synthetic ones are typically better for cream formulas. Investing in a quality brush can enhance application and longevity.

3. Size Matters

The size of the blush brush can affect the level of precision in your application. A smaller brush allows for more control, while a larger brush can provide a diffused finish across a broader area.

Tips for Using a Beauty Blush Brush

1. Start with a Light Hand

When applying blush, especially if you’re using a pigmented product, it’s best to start with a light hand. You can always build up the color gradually.

2. Blend, Blend, Blend

To achieve a natural look, ensure that you blend the blush well into your skin. Use circular motions or gentle strokes to blend the product evenly.

3. Clean Regularly

To maintain hygiene and brush performance, make sure to clean your blush brush regularly. Use a gentle cleanser and let it dry flat to keep the bristles in shape.
